What are the Social Anxiety Disorder Treatments?

Social Anxiety Disorder is a mental disorder that has now affected over 1 in 8 individuals in America.

For the sufferers of social anxiety, social situations can grow a living hell. Social anxiety ruins lives and will normally split up your family relationships and bust up other parts of your life. Social situations are the most feared situation for a sufferer.
Don`t worry as there are many ways to combat this disorder. Social anxiety disorder treatments can be obtained like prescribed medicinal drug, counseling and self support support groups which all assistance you fight this disorder. After seeking treatment, there are things that you can do to assistance alleviate stressful social situations and ways to begin to reacquaint yourself with friends and family members.
To start with read all you can find about social anxiety disorder. Check outyour library for records on social anxiety disorder. Look for records on any personal developments. You can not just  click your fingers and have this disorder just disappear You need to learn everything you can on the topic and subjects that will support you re-build your own self-worth.

Get a journal and start summing up the days, calendar weeks and months. write down each day how your feeling on that day. publish a note on any events that made you nerve-wracking or anxiuos. How did the situation go? How did any social interaction go, what were your levels of tension?

At the end of the week, check out the notes and see if you can see patterns amerging. At the end of the month, publish 2 pages in your journal. The first page should sum up any difficult situations and how you defeat the situation, or how you dealt with it. The 2nd page should summarise the social events and social situations where you felt easy and why you felt comfortable. Which page succeeds? This may seem like a lot of work but you will get a great deal of usable data from making it.
Set goals that you have to make. If you are highly distressed at the promenade, then go to the shopping centre and walk in. Take small measures everytime your how you feel disturbed about a social situation and never back down.
